Fonts Graduation!

The Fonts have certainly been a memorable class at the Kitten Academy!  Pregnant momcat Arial was taken in, and then immediately delivered her babies while in the care of Animal Control.  Shortly after, she and her kittens were admitted to the Kitten Academy.  When Charlie later joined the class, she instantly accepted him as one of her own.  While Charlie played the rougher, bigger brother to the Fonts, the Fonts also taught him a lot about being a cat!  And Arial was a wonderful mom to all.

Normally, these graduation announcements are thinly-veiled pleas for adopters to adopt our graduates.  But the Fonts class represents a milestone in Kitten Academy history - this is the first time that you wonderful Kitten Academy viewers have adopted all the kittens prior to graduation!  You truly are the best people in the world!

Zapf and Baskerville were adopted together, and so were Gary and Winnie.  It's always a pleasure to see these kittens go in pairs, since they love each other so much already.

Our momcat, Arial, has some potential applicants -- and so does our former momcat, Velvet, who's still enjoying her time at On Angels' Wings.  However, Velvet's already had two applications fall through, so if you're thinking of adopting either of these wonderful cats, please don't let the fact that there's a line stop you from putting in an application now.  If nothing else, it will help ensure you're pre-approved when the next wonderful cat comes available!

The Fonts had their spay/neuter, vaccinations, and microchipping yesterday.  They will go to their adopters tomorrow, Saturday the 18th.  Except Arial, who will go to On Angels' Wings in Crystal Lake.

Finally, we've had a lot of people ask about Charlie and his story.  So just a little clarification!  Charlie was born on December 19th, and hand-raised by one of the wonderful people who foster for On Angels' Wings.  Meanwhile, Arial was picked up by Animal Control on January 5th, and delivered her four kittens at Animal Control on the 6th.  Then she was brought in to On Angels' Wings, and from there, to the Kitten Academy.  Once Charlie was old enough to be weaned, he was also brought to Kitten Academy, so that he could be socialized and hopefully, learn to cat!  Arial accepted him as part of her family almost immediately, despite being about 2.5 weeks older than her own kittens.  He sometimes plays a little too rough for his adoptive siblings, which is why we take him out of the Annex occasionally -- to give them a break!
